The Globus Group, a prominent German retailer developing the Globus hypermarket grocery chain, has leased 45,000 m² at Industrial Park Kholmogory, a Class A complex located in the Moscow region. JLL advised on the deal which represents the first direct lease contract by Globus in Russia. The transaction was closed before commissioning of the property.

 

The price remains confidential, although this deal represents the largest leasing transaction of an international food retail chain ever in Russia.

 

Industrial Park Kholmogory is located 30 km away from the Moscow Ring Road near Yaroslavskoye Highway. The 57 ha plot has good traffic access: situated on the Yaroslavskoye Highway, also known as the M-8 Kholmogory Highway, in proximity and with direct access to the A-107 highway (the “Betonka” Beltway). The project will have a total area of 250,000 m². The first phase, 91,500 m² in size, was commissioned in Q2 2015. The developer, the Kholmogory company, aims to become one of the largest developers on the industrial and warehousing property market and raise its project portfolio to 1 million m².

 

The Globus hypermarket chain dates back to 1828. It has been successfully growing on the Russian market since 2006 and currently has 10 stores in the Moscow region and elsewhere. The 11th and largest hypermarket will open in Pushkino this November. The complex in Kholmogory will house a fully-fledged distribution center for Globus. The developer has built storage facilities with several temperature regimes to the tenant's specifications, including 11,200 m² of cold storage facilities and dry warehouses. Globus intends to start working on new platform in October.

Petr Zaritskiy, Regional Director, Head of Warehouse and Industrial Department, JLL, Russia & CIS: “Today, grocery retailers are among the most active tenants and buyers of warehousing space on the Russian market. This market segment remains stable even in times of economic uncertainty, and long-term planning horizons provide food operators with the opportunity to benefit from current market conditions and occupy prime-quality warehouses. The 45,000 sq m leased at Kholmogory is a record-setting deal of an international grocery retailer on the Russia warehousing market. It is also in the top 5 largest warehouse leasing transactions of foreign companies in the Russian history. This confirms the market's excellent potential and its appeal to foreign players despite the overall economic situation.”
